  • Hey GMC'ers! This time I´ve prepared a lesson based on a song from my future solo album, as I did in a previous exercise called "Petrucci Melody Build Up".

    The solo starts with the B Minor Harmonic scale, with the 2nd string open, a resource used by many shredders like Petrucci, Satriani, and Timmons. Later there's a tapping section, created mainly in the E Minor Pentatonic scale, using passing notes as Flat 5 of the same scale. The idea is to visualize this Pentatonic in different ways.

    Tuning:
    * One Step Down
    * D - G - C - F - A - D
    (From thick to thin string)

    Key:
    G Major

    Chord Progression:
    B - G5 - E5

    Techniques:
    * Bends
    * Legato
    * Tapping
    * Sweep Picking
    * Let Notes Ring

    Scales:
    * B Minor Harmonic
    * E Dorian
    * G Lydian
